Picus Security Activity Logs API

The Activity-Logs API from Picus Security — 1 operation(s) for activity-logs.

Picus Security Activity Logs API is one of 14 APIs that Picus Security publ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include Activity Logs.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ification, API documentation, an API reference, a getting-started guide, authentication docs, and rate-limit docs.

This API exposes 1 operation across 1 path, and defines 2 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version 1.0.

Requests are made against a single base URL, https://api.picussecurity.com/.

Picus Security Activity Logs API declares 1 security scheme for authenticating requests. An API key is passed in the header as Authorization (Access-Token). By default, every request must be authenticated.

  • Access-Token — After getting the access token, type Bearer accessToken to the Value input box to request access to the below endpoints For example Bearer eyJhbGciOiJIUzI1NiIs…
